Kernersville Cares for Kids (KCK) presented its annual report to the Kernersville Board of Aldermen earlier this month after submitting funding requests for the upcoming year.
KCK Board Member Dr. Reneé Rogers, a department chair at Forsyth Technical Community College, presented the aldermen with the organization’s yearly report. The local middle and high school anti-drug/alcohol program is asking the Town of Kernersville for $6,500 in funding for fiscal year 2021-22, the same amount the non-profit received this past year.
